Romani Language Day seen as important for cultural identity

Ljubljana, 3 November - A round table debate on the history of the Romani language was held in Ljubljana on Friday ahead of International Romani Language Day, which the participants assessed as having great importance for the preservation of cultural identity of the Romani people.
